Identify House Use Officers for advanced filtering and reporting in House Use operations.


Business Value

  • Enables Targeted Filtering: Easily filter House Use Reports by authorized officers for more accurate reporting and auditing.
  • Improves Data Accuracy: Clearly marks profiles with House Use authority, preventing mistakes or misuse.
  • Streamlines House Use Processes: Simplifies workflow for POS and front office teams when managing House Use transactions for managers or complimentary guests.

Use Cases

  • Housekeeping Manager: Needs to review only transactions authorized by House Use Officers.
  • Auditors: Can quickly check compliance by filtering profiles marked as House Use Officers.
  • Point of Sale: Accurately assigns and tracks POS House Use invoices to the appropriate officer.

What’s New?

New Checkbox Field:
  • Label: House Use Officer
  • Default: Unchecked (false)
  • Location: Appears within the profile details section.
  • Searchable: Can be filtered in the profile list and is displayed as the last column in the listing.
How does it work?
  • Assigning: When creating or editing an individual profile, check the box if the guest is authorized as a House Use Officer.
  • Filtering: Use the profile list’s search or filters to show only profiles with the House Use Officer flag enabled.
  • Reporting: The House Use Report will now support filtering or restricting results to profiles with this flag.
